About Tielin Shi
Tielin Shi is a scholar working on Control and Systems Engineering, Industrial and Manufacturing Engineering and Surfaces, Coatings and Films, having authored 318 papers that have together received 6.7k indexed citations. Recurring topics across this work include Machine Fault Diagnosis Techniques (38 papers), Topology Optimization in Engineering (26 papers), Fault Detection and Control Systems (26 papers), Gear and Bearing Dynamics Analysis (26 papers), Advanced machining processes and optimization (25 papers), Industrial Vision Systems and Defect Detection (23 papers), Supercapacitor Materials and Fabrication (21 papers) and Composite Structure Analysis and Optimization (20 papers). The work is most often cited by research in Industrial and Manufacturing Engineering (631 citations), Bioengineering (319 citations) and Civil and Structural Engineering (1.1k citations). Tielin Shi has collaborated with scholars based in China, United States and Hong Kong. Frequent co-authors include Guanglan Liao, Zirong Tang, Qi Xia, Jianping Xuan, Shiyuan Liu, Hu Long, Siyi Cheng, Xianhua Tan, Carlo Carraro and Roya Maboudian. Their work appears in journals such as SHILAP Revista de lepidopterología, ACS Nano and Journal of Applied Physics.
